Abstract

A content control server implements a service similar to the National Do-Not-Call Registry for on-line content in which a user of a device can request that advertising content received from an ad server be restricted to one or more types of acceptable content. The types of content that are to be allowed and/or denied delivery to the device are associated with an identifier of the device. The identifier can be a digital fingerprint of the device. The types of content that can be controlled in the manner described herein are organized in a hierarchy.

Claims (43)

1 . A method for controlling content delivery to a device through a computer network, the method comprising:

receiving content type data from the device wherein the content type data represents one or more types of content that is to be denied delivery to the device;

storing the content type data with an identifier of the device;

receiving content delivery data representing an intent to deliver one or more types of content to the device;

determining that one or more denied ones of the types of content represented by the content delivery data are also types of content represented by the content type data; and

denying delivery to the device of content of the one or more denied types.

2 . The method of claim 1 wherein the device identifier is a digital fingerprint of the device.

3 . The method of claim 1 wherein the content type data represents one or more types of content that is to be denied delivery to the device implicitly by explicitly representing one or more types of content that are exclusively to be allowed delivery to the device.

4 . The method of claim 1 wherein the content type data represents one or more types of content of a larger collection of types of content wherein the collection of types of content is hierarchical.

5 . The method of claim 4 wherein determining that one or more denied ones of the types of content represented by the content delivery data are also types of content represented by the content type data comprises:

determining that the content type data represents a first type of content that is to be denied delivery to the device; and

determining that the content delivery data represents an intent to deliver a second type of content to the device;

wherein the first type of content is a parent of the second type of content within the hierarchy of the collection of types of content.
